Will Finds a Win, Tim Finds the Tin

Another two wins in January made it three in a row for the 1st team as we find ourselves 2nd place in Div. 2.

All but one of the 5 matches played against Crawley needed a deciding 5th game to determine a winner. With the tie balanced at 2 apiece, it was up to young Will Johnson to play out the deciding game.

Despite going two games down to a tricky opponent, Will was able to dig in and turn it into a 3-2 win not only for himself but for the team.

This was followed up by another win, this time against Bognor. The team were able to welcome back Lee Welch after a lengthy injury and sealed a comfortable win.

Once again the 2nd and 3rd teams were pitted against each other, this time with the 3rds acting as the ‘Home’ team. The 2nds were able to record their second win of the season, the first of course coming in the reverse fixture at the beginning of the season.

No Win Tim Canham was up to his old tricks again as the 4th team notched a 3rd win of the season against West Worthing.

Wins for each of his team mates ensured a strong victory for the 4ths; however a win for Tim remains as elusive as ever.

When I questioned Captain Jon Tucker as to whether Tim had still not claimed victory this season, he had this to say;

‘…you are in fact partially right. He is still without a team win this season, but this builds on his complete absence of wins for the whole of last season as well.’
